Natural or Engineered wood floors near ocean

We will shortly build a new home near the ocean in the northeast and wondering if engineered wood is a safer option than natural wood floors against cupping and other probs in a humid environment. We will want relatively wide plank, which I know will require gluing and not just nailing and know that the temperature and humidity of the floor and base need to be controlled at the time of installation.


We do like to have windows open when we can so the interior heat/humidity will not be always be strictly controlled after we are in the home.
